The Role:

The role of NPD & Packaging Coordinator is responsible for assisting the NPD Manager in all aspects of new product development. This will include sourcing components, new packaging development, compliance management and managing and tracking timelines, whilst contributing to the company’s overall NPD Strategy.

We are looking for someone with a genuine passion for skincare and holistic therapies combined with experience of working with a luxury brand. You must be self-motivated with a proactive and flexible approach to tasks with strong project management skills ideally from the skincare or beauty environment.

Experience in sourcing components and packaging through third party suppliers is essential, along with the ability to manage your time effectively and cope with a wide range of demands in a rapidly expanding company. In addition to the above, excellent communication skills and strong IT/administration skills are vitally important.

The Responsibilities:

Manage the daily running of new product development coordination tools including schedules, checklists and critical paths.

Prepare for and schedule all NPD meetings and manage NPD tools in the meetings (schedules, budgets, checklists and trackers) as required. Update and monitor all related actions and ensure timely completion.

Possess strong project planning skills to manage and track project timelines and critical paths to achieve launch timings and identify risks to ensure the successful launch of all new products.

Work alongside the chemists to support the management of new formulation testing and internal and external user trials in line with the project timelines.

Source, develop and project manage non-skincare product lines.

Co-ordinate efficacy testing with the testing houses in line with the project timelines.

Assist with all aspects of compliance management to ensure all new products meet required standards and documentation is maintained.

Source components as required and work closely with manufacturers to deliver the goods whilst developing long- term relationships with key suppliers; chemists, our factory and external suppliers.

Track and monitor all costs in conjunction with individual NPD projects to ensure costs are kept within budget.

As required, evaluate trends and carry out competitor research at a field and desk level for new projects.

Assist with briefing the formulators on new concepts and sourcing of components, including alltechnical data.

Track the receipt of new product samples, and how these are distributed within the business whilst co-ordinating user trials. Provide support to the users and request prompt feedback.

Support with the accurate and timely provision of key information and new packaging development ensuring all packaging for new launches are in place in a timely manner prior to start date ready for pre-production trials.

Coordinate a range of packaging related activities, track the receipt of new packaging samples and co-ordinate with the chemist testing requirements.

Co-ordinate with the Studio for all new or existing packaging / artwork from creation, proofing and standards approval.
